Ashland Lakes — Sunday, May. 26, 2019

North Cascades > Mountain Loop Highway

Loaded up the wife and kids and headed to Ashland Lake looking for a fun hike with as little trail traffic as possible. The drive in is pretty wild. Took us 30 minutes to cover the last 4 miles. Pot holes, meteor impacts, mortar shell explosions - the road is rough. Would not recommend driving up this without a high clearance vehicle. We arrived at the trailhead just before noon on Saturday. There were 4 cars in the lot and not a person to be seen. Trail is in good condition. Beware - the planks are super slick. All four of us took a dive at least once! Many wet spots, mud holes abound, and a few large trees down throughout. The kids had no problem making their way around all the obstacles. We had lunch at the very end of the trail (at lower Ashland Lake). Saw a total of 12 people on the trail. Made it back to the parking lot around 4:30. There were about 10 cars and a few groups just heading up the trail. GPS had us at 6 miles total - including the small detour to Beaver Plant Lake.
